Who had command economies during the cold war

Several countries had command economies during the Cold War. The most notable ones were the Soviet Union, which had a centrally planned economy; China, which adopted a command economy under Mao Zedong's leadership; and the countries of Eastern Europe, including East Germany, Poland, Hungary, Czechoslovakia, and Romania, which were part of the Soviet-led Eastern Bloc and implemented command economies based on the Soviet model.
